Overview

Pro-inflammatory cytokines and adhesion molecules represent a diverse group of proteins that orchestrate the body's inflammatory response and immune cell trafficking. Pro-inflammatory cytokines, such as Tumor Necrosis Factor-alpha (TNF-α), Interleukin-1 (IL-1), and Interleukin-6 (IL-6), are signaling proteins secreted by immune cells to promote inflammation and coordinate the host defense against pathogens (StatPearls, 2023). Adhesion molecules, including Selectins, Integrins, and members of the Immunoglobulin superfamily like ICAM-1 and VCAM-1, are expressed on the surface of leukocytes and endothelial cells to facilitate the recruitment and migration of immune cells into tissues (NCBI, 2021). Dysregulation of these molecules is central to the pathogenesis of various conditions, including rheumatoid arthritis, inflammatory bowel disease, and atherosclerosis (PubMed, 2022). Pharmacological intervention typically involves the use of monoclonal antibodies or small molecule inhibitors to block specific cytokines or their receptors, or to prevent the interaction between adhesion molecules and their ligands, thereby dampening the inflammatory cascade (Nature Reviews Drug Discovery, 2020).

Mechanism of action

Neutralization of pro-inflammatory cytokines, blockade of cytokine receptors, and inhibition of leukocyte-endothelial cell adhesion through binding to integrins or selectins.
